JP SPRUILL, FOLK ART MODEL USS HERRING, SS233: GATO Class Submarine Launched 15 January 1942 at Portsmouth Naval Shipyard in Kittery, Maine. Fought in the Mediterranean, Atlantic and Pacific. Sunk 7 ships and was Lost with all Hands 1 June 1944. Model was Made from a Sourwood Tree Branch from the Grounds of the Mariners Museum in Newport News, Virginia. Measures 14" x 44" x 21", weighs in at 50 LBS. Made at the Spruill Backyard Shipway in 2007. JP always Like Herrings hence the Interest in this Ship. (500-1250)
